The Eagan Ice Crystal Figure Skating Club is a non-profit organization, dedicated to promoting the
sport of figure skating. We are proud to have the Eagan Civic Arena as our home rink. The Club is a member of the
USFSA, which is the governing body of figure skating.
The purpose of the club is to encourage the instruction, practice, and advancement of the members in any of the
disciplines of figure skating, and to encourage and cultivate a spirit of fraternal feeling among the
youth of the community. We primarily serve the Eagan, Apple Valley, Farmington, Lakeville, Burnsville, Inver Grove Heights, and Mendota Heights area as well as School District 196.
